Viral Marketing With Email

You Can Achieve Viral Marketing Objectives With Email

Viral Marketing Tips For First-Timers - Producing and publishing (re: distributing, broadcasting, emailing, etc.) a message with a quality offer or an incentive for pass-along is what it is all about.

Viral marketing is significant component of a campaign strategy that is used to achieve objectives. It is not the objective itself. If the main objective of an e-mail campaign is branding, in order to achieve greater branding success exposure you craft your message or offer in a way that it encourages pass-along.

A strategy of just suggesting that your e-mail recipients forward your message to their friends and relatives is not effective marketing that is viral. Neither is a message at the bottom of your e-mail that reads “feel free to forward this message to a friend.”

On the other hand, if something worthy of sharing, such as an interesting or funny video, a good joke/cartoon, an online coupon, is included in the e-mail, viral happens naturally and quite successfully.

The bottom line is that your message must be perceived as having value. Relevant or timely information, research, or studies are all good examples of content that might be viewed as potential pass-along material. Interactive content like a quiz or text can inspire forwarding, especially if it is fun. Personality tests, relationship surveys, fitness quizzes, or compatibility questionnaires are all things that have been passed on by many people many times. Why? Because they are entertaining and entertainment has perceived value.

With texting, blogging, facebooking, etc. the sharing of content with friends is the perfect environment for viral marketing. Not only are people sharing content with each other more than ever, also, whatever is shared comes with the “recommendation from a friend” effect that also adds value.

A multimedia experience is always going to achieve some pass-along. Someone is always touting the benefits. It is a bit more of a time and money investment but the messages have a great appeal and rich media has the advantage of being new. The tech factor alone is often enough for the message to be perceived as valuable.

Of course, there should be no confusion regarding effective email versus viral. Email marketing is the most effective method of marketing online. Making the email viral adds to the effectiveness when done correctly.
